Windows 10为什么会截断用户名?[关闭]


13

如果您使用Microsoft帐户而非本地帐户安装Windows 10,它将把用户名截断为五个字母,并将其用作用户目录和其他一些内容。(您可以使用以下命令修复用户目录:https : //superuser.com/a/955026/310715

我的问题似乎找不到答案,这是为什么!Microsoft为什么将链接帐户的用户名截断为五个字符?换句话说,为什么会发生截断以及为什么(看似)任意长度?

编辑:由于主要产生基于意见的答案,该问题已被关闭。我猜想这个推论是只有Microsoft才能知道他们选择截断的原因以及他们选择五个字符的原因。但是,如果他们的想法发表在某个地方,或者某人已经获得认证的知识,那么我认为仍然存在潜伏的答案。请,如果您有信息或潜在客户,请添加评论。


1
@DaaBoss,但是,要截断符号处的广告,而不是将其截断为5个字符,是有道理的,因为无论如何它将句柄与域分开。
下撤

1
正如您所提到的提到类似情况的上一个问题所暗示的那样,初始设置Windows 10配置文件的最优雅的方法是首先使用本地登录帐户,然后将其“转换”为您的Microsoft帐户。除了创建标准的配置文件文件夹层次结构之外,当您联机检查以查看哪些计算机名称附加到您的Microsoft帐户(用于数字权利许可证等)时,它也有所不同。如果在重命名计算机之前使用Microsoft帐户进行初始设置,则该通用计算机名称将保留在线状态。
2016年

3
我不知道两个用户名共享相同的前5个字符会怎样?
Stevoisiak

1
@AlexZhukovskiy我上周末刚刚安装了W10 3次,现在却以某种方式将我的用户名截断为5个字母
phuclv

1
“ 5个字母应该足以代表任何人的名字。” -Gates
Amit Naidu

Answers:


0

在此直接回答问题之前,显然需要更多测试。没有更多的测试,这个答案充其量是不完整的。

(YMMV)-有关在安装Windows 10时初始设置用户名的建议每次
在PC上创建新用户时,我认为您应该首先使用本地帐户,该帐户用于设置用户的文件夹结构名称,如C:\Users\[localAccount]文件夹中一样。然后,如果您确实要登录,并将Microsoft注册的电子邮件地址附加到PC登录名,则不会更改文件夹结构。

由于某些电子邮件地址将非常长,因此将其用作用户名,该用户名将成为当前登录用户的根文件夹,这将给程序和用户带来麻烦。通常,生成的日志将包含该用户的电子邮件地址。这些日志通常由用户发送或发布,这将发布该用户的电子邮件地址。


1
那不是问题。我有一个真实帐户的真实Windows用户名,该名称someuser与真实电子邮件地址完全无关,但是登录其他计算机后,它将被截断为someu
phuclv

我还想补充一点,该@符号除了其明显的字符外,还可能具有多种含义,从而导致文件夹名称出现问题。据我所记得,文件夹名称不能包含该特殊字符。
Kaizerwolf

@Kaizerwolf @不是文件名中的禁止字符
phuclv

大声笑,当我回到某个话题想再次投票时,这很有趣。就像@LưuVĩnhPhúc指出的那样,这并不能回答我提出的问题:为什么会发生截断,为什么会出现任意长度?人们认为,电子邮件构造与之无关。即使是长度问题,为什么还要davka这样的长度?
下撤

显然,这还不止于此。...我想改善我的答案,但我没有意识到这里的许多问题,更不用说微软为什么要这样做了。我的回答还试图为用户在安装Windows时应使用的建议添加有用的内容。到目前为止,我的测试太过轶事和有限。但是,我将开始在不同情况下创建帐户以更好地理解。在您的问题之外,要求更多的外部资源来阐明该主题可能也会有所帮助。
DaaBoss
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.